What Are Consumer Protection Laws?
Consumer protection laws give buyers legal rights to make sure they are not getting ripped off, taken advantage of, or put in danger. There are federal and California consumer protection laws covering everything from payday loans to buying a vehicle, including those covering:
- Deceptive business practices
- Lemon laws
- Consumer credit protections
- Defective product claims
- Phone scam and telemarketer restrictions
- Debt collection practices
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Consumer Protection Lawyer?
As a consumer, you have to be vigilant when you put your money on the line. When you buy a product, it should be safe and work for its intended purpose. Unfortunately, scammers and untrustworthy companies will do whatever they can to get your hard-earned money. Situations where you might want to talk to a consumer protection lawyer include:
- You bought a new or used car that has repeated problems that can’t be fixed
- Creditors are harassing you or threatening you
- You were hurt by a defective product
- Marketers call after you put your name on the Do Not Call Registry
- Business sale ads don’t reflect the true prices
- A business is refusing to cover damages under the warranty you bought
How Can a Consumer Protection Lawyer Help Me?
A consumer protection lawyer can help you take action against deceptive businesses to put a stop to their illegal practices. A lawyer can review your case and identify who is responsible. Your lawyer can also explain your legal options and file a lawsuit so you can recover the compensation you are entitled to, including money for:
- Medical bills
- Property damage
- Lost wages
- Punitive damages
- Triple money damages
- Attorney fees

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Consumer Protection Lawyer in Running Springs?
These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case. Many consumer protection lawyers offer an initial consultation that allows you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ions include:
- What is your experience in handling consumer protection cases in California?
- Have you represented consumers in cases like mine?
- What are potential issues that can come up during consumer protection cases?
- How will you keep me informed about updates in my case?
- What is the likely timeline for resolving my consumer protection case?
- How much can I receive in damages for my consumer protection lawsuit?
